     The thing on the end of the leaves is a seed pod & should be discarded 
or else taken off before the seeds dispurse & the seeds planted  in a buried 
pot. The leaves do not need cutting until they turn brown. Fertilize with 
Superphosptate,1 tablespoon per clump, dug into the soil not touching the 
rhizomes (not bulbs) which should be close if not showing on the top of the 
soil. I fertilize both Fall & Spring. Plant rhizomes in full sun as possible 
but at least 6 hours of sunshine is needed for bloom.
